CHATHAM – A spokesperson for the Cape and Islands District Attorney’s office confirms that late Monday afternoon police responded to a report of a possible accidental drowning near North Beach in Chatham. The deceased has been identified as David Murdoch, 78, of Chatham. The matter remains under investigation by Massachusetts State Police, Chatham Police and the Massachusetts Environmental Police. There is nothing at this time to suggest the cause of death was anything other than accidental.
